Tell me what I'm missing? My Cooper 305/70/16 spare fit in betwen the rails. Oo. It was snug, but had about a 1/4 inch on each side. It rests on the inside tailpipe hanger a tad and is about 1/2 inch from the pipe
I checked with a mirror and 1m candle power spot light - high, low and all around the tire frame etc. nothing touches anywhere. Only thing that might come close is the rear end cover, but if the suspension ever allowed the body to drop that low there would still be about 1 inch gap and the shock is about 1 inch from touching the top edge of the tire. No wire looms are crushed and any that are near move freely.
